description | F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 8.0.0) Involved in several processes, including negative regulation of intracellular estrogen receptor signaling pathway; positive regulation of mammary stem cell proliferation; and positive regulation of somatic stem cell division. Acts upstream of or within positive regulation of DNA-templated transcription. Located in nucleus. Is expressed in several structures, including gut; heart; limb bud; mesendoderm; and nervous system. Orthologous to human LBH (LBH regulator of WNT signaling pathway). P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a knock-out allele exhibit impaired mammary gland development and decreased litter size.
